Where is Rucksack Inn Tyrwhitt Road?

Where is Rucksack Inn Tyrwhitt Road located?

Rucksack Inn Tyrwhitt Road, Rucksack Inn Tyrwhitt Road, Singapore (approx. 1.31187°, 103.86029°)


Where is Rucksack Inn Tyrwhitt Road on the map?